Protecting synthetic chlorinated swimming pools necessitates regular checking of chlorine levels and h2o quality. Pool operators and homeowners should Examine the chlorine concentration often to make sure it stays within the suggested variety. As well little chlorine can lead to insufficient sanitation, letting micro organism and algae to thrive. However, excessive chlorine concentrations could potentially cause skin and eye irritation for swimmers. The best chlorine degree for synthetic chlorinated pools usually falls between one and 3 areas for each million (ppm). Sustaining this equilibrium is important for supplying a cushty and Safe and sound swimming working experience.

Besides chlorine concentrations, artificial chlorinated swimming pools need correct pH harmony. The pH of pool h2o need to Preferably be amongst seven.two and 7.six. If your pH is simply too low, the h2o becomes acidic, resulting in corrosion of pool gear and distress for swimmers. If the pH is too significant, chlorine will become significantly less efficient, cutting down its power to sanitize the drinking water. Regular testing and adjustment of pH ranges help be certain that artificial chlorinated pools continue being nicely-balanced and comfy for people. Pool owners frequently use pH testing kits and chemical changes to take care of the right pH degrees inside their pools.

Yet another critical aspect of synthetic chlorinated pools is using stabilizers. Chlorine can degrade speedily when subjected to daylight, minimizing its effectiveness to be a disinfectant. To fight this, pool house owners usually insert cyanuric acid, a stabilizer that assists lengthen the life of chlorine in outdoor swimming pools. With no stabilizers, chlorine amounts can drop rapidly, necessitating Recurrent additions to maintain right sanitation. By utilizing the suitable volume of stabilizer, synthetic chlorinated swimming pools can stay cleaner for for a longer time intervals with minimal chlorine reduction.

Artificial chlorinated swimming pools also call for plan servicing beyond chemical balancing. Filtration systems Engage in a vital position in holding the h2o clean up by eradicating particles, dirt, and natural make any difference. Pool filters, such as sand filters, cartridge filters, and diatomaceous earth filters, assistance trap impurities and prevent them from circulating within the water. Typical cleaning and backwashing of filters make sure they functionality proficiently. Furthermore, pool house owners should skim the water surface, vacuum the pool floor, and brush the pool partitions to avoid algae buildup and manage water clarity. Appropriate servicing assists artificial chlorinated pools stay in optimum issue for swimmers.

Lately, There have been an increased give attention to eco-helpful alternatives for synthetic chlorinated swimming pools. Some pool owners and operators are exploring ways to lessen chemical utilization when protecting h2o high quality. A single different is the usage of ozone or ultraviolet (UV) gentle devices, which get the job done together with chlorine to reinforce disinfection and lower the quantity of chemical compounds essential. These devices enable break down contaminants and minimize chlorine byproducts, producing the water gentler around the pores and skin and eyes. On top of that, progress in filtration technology have enhanced the effectiveness of water circulation and purification, contributing to cleaner plus more sustainable pool servicing procedures.

Despite the lots of benefits of artificial chlorinated swimming pools, it is vital for pool owners and operators to abide by basic safety recommendations and best techniques. Appropriate storage and managing of chlorine and also other pool chemicals are very important to stop incidents and chemical imbalances. Chlorine needs to be saved within a neat, dry spot clear of direct daylight and incompatible substances. Mixing chlorine with other substances, including ammonia or acids, can produce hazardous reactions. Pool routine maintenance personnel must be properly trained in chemical security and observe recommended suggestions for dealing with and software.
